A solar panel, also known as a photovoltaic panel, is a device that converts sunlight directly into electricity.

Understanding its Role in Modern Energy Solutions A Container Battery Energy Storage System (BESS) refers to a modular, scalable energy storage solution that houses batteries, power electronics, and control systems within a standardized shipping container. In 2025, average turnkey container prices range around USD 200 to USD 400 per kWh depending on capacity, components, and location of deployment. But this range hides much nuance—anything from battery chemistry to cooling systems to permits and integration. . A battery energy storage system container (or simply energy storage container) combines batteries, power conversion, thermal control, safety, and management into a modular “box” ready for deployment. Financing and transaction costs - at current interest rates, these can be around 20% of total project costs.
